You've seen the ads: "$49 Towing!" Then you get the bill, and it's $300. Mileage charges, after-hours fees, fuel surcharges—they all appear after the fact because "the base rate" was the bait.
Or maybe you've had a tow driver show up, hook your car to a chain, and drag it onto the bed at an angle that scraped the undercarriage. "That's just how it's done," they said. But now you've got scratches that weren't there before.
Here's the uncomfortable truth about the towing industry: it attracts a lot of operators who care more about volume than your vehicle's condition. They've got low prices because they cut corners—on equipment, on driver training, on insurance coverage.

Standard passenger vehicles require specific handling—proper wheel lifts, correct weight distribution, appropriate tie-downs. We tow sedans, coupes, and hatchbacks using equipment calibrated for their size and geometry. Your daily driver gets the same care we'd give a collector's item.
Larger vehicles present different challenges: higher ground clearance, different weight distribution, sometimes all-wheel-drive systems that require flatbed transport rather than wheel lifts. We assess your SUV's drivetrain and select the appropriate towing method.
Pickup trucks and light-duty commercial vehicles require heavier equipment and more robust securing methods. We maintain a fleet capable of handling trucks up to certain weight limits, with proper lighting and flagging for highway transport.

The moments after a car accident are overwhelming. Here's what you need to know about the towing process before you need it—so when adrenaline is high and decisions matter, you're not starting from scratch.
Take photos of everything. Your vehicle from multiple angles, the other vehicle(s), the road conditions, any visible injuries. Exchange information with other drivers—names, phone numbers, insurance companies, license plates. If police are responding, get the report number before they leave.
You have the right to choose your own tow company. Insurance or police may recommend one, but you're not obligated. If you're unsure, ask for 15 minutes to make your own call. A company that can't wait 15 minutes for you to decide isn't one you want handling your vehicle.
Walk around your vehicle with the driver. Note any existing damage on the condition report. Remove valuables from the car if possible. If your vehicle is towed to a storage yard, find out operating hours before you leave—you'll need to retrieve belongings and arrange repairs quickly to avoid daily storage fees.
